Privacy guidance material for the community
The Office of the Privacy Commissioner has produced, with the assistance of
Neighbourhood Support, 5 x A5 sized full colour advice cards about keeping your personal
information safe.
The cards are:





Protecting yourself against scams
Keeping your information safe online
Keeping your financial information safe
You control your health information
Your personal information is valuable
You can order these cards free of charge for your organisation or group to distribute to its
members.
